Fav¬ orite games are football and fighting. Ambition—to join the Air Force. SCHOOL CALENDAR AUGUST: 28—School starts. SEPTEMBER: 23—Council and committee elections. OCTOBER: 9—Film “Thunderhead” shown in school. 2—Niverville went to Grunthal for a football game. 16—Grunthal came to Niverville for a football game. 23— Roller-skating party for Grades 9 to 12. 30-31—Teachers’ Convention NOVEMBER: 11—Remembrance Day Services. —Vote for larger school division (holiday). 20— Literary evening was held. 26— Grades 9-12 attended Winnipeg Symphony Orchestra. 23- 30— ' Christmas examinations. DECEMBER: 4—Film “Alice in Wonderland” shown in school. 8— Parent-Teacher Meeting. 16— Trustee elections (holiday). 21— Christmas social (Grades 9-12). 22— Christmas programme held in school auditorium. 24- Jan. 4—Christmas holidays. JANUARY: 22—Film “Alexander Graham Bell” shown in school. FEBRUARY: 17— Grades 9-12 went tobogganing at Maple Grove. 18— Niverville went to Bothwell for a hockey game. 24— Mr. Hilton from M.T.A. instructed on Alcohol Education. MARCH: 3-4—High School Play “Let’s Be Congenial” held in school. 9— Film “Pride and Prejudice” shown to Grades 9-12. 11—Niverville went to Grunlthal for a hockey game. 15—Open House and Parent-Teacher Meeting. 28-Apr. 1—Easter examinations. APRIL: 8—Film “Snow White and the Seven Dwarfs” shown in school. 14—Easter programme held in school. 15-25—Easter holidays. MAY: 27— -Graduation. JUNE: 21-30—Departmental examinations. Page 24
